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s) About Emergency Management Degree Programs In Chalco, Nebraska
What is emergency management? Emergency management involves preparing for, responding to, and recovering from disasters.
What can I do with a degree in emergency management? Graduates can work in various roles, including emergency management directors, planners, or disaster recovery specialists.
What are the salary ranges for emergency management professionals? Salaries vary widely; entry-level positions may start around $40,000, while experienced directors can earn over $100,000 annually.
Is financial aid available for emergency management programs? Yes, students can apply for federal aid, state scholarships, and institutional scholarships.
Are online programs available? Many colleges offer online or hybrid programs, allowing flexibility for working students.
How can I gain practical experience while studying? Look for internships, volunteer opportunities, and local community engagement projects.
What skills do I need for a career in emergency management? Key skills include critical thinking, communication, problem-solving, and leadership.
Do I need certification after graduation? While not required, obtaining FEMA certifications can enhance job prospects.
